变质软岩深埋特长隧道综合地质勘察方法探讨 被引量:1

Research on Method of Comprehensive Geological Survey for Deep Buried Super Long Tunnel in Metamorphic Soft Rock

摘要 以十堰至巫溪高速公路鲍峡至溢水段鸡公寨隧道工程为依托,通过采用大面积地质调绘、岩性与构造专项调查、综合物探、钻探、综合测试与试验等勘察方法,查明了隧道深部的围岩条件和地质构造特征,获得了隧道围岩分级与稳定性计算所需参数,分析了地应力对隧道围岩变形的影响。 Based on Jigongzhai tunnel of Baoxia to Yishui section in Shiyan to Wuxi highway, through the adoption of large area geological annotation, lithology and tectonic special survey, comprehensive geophysical prospecting, drilling, comprehensive test and experiment, the conditions of the surrounding rock and the geological structure characteristics of the deep tunnel are found out, the parameters required by tunnel surrounding rock classification and stability calculation are obtained and the influence of ground stress on tunnel surrounding rock deformation is analyzed.
